Kathmandu. Nepal Investment Mega Bank has become the most profitable bank in the first quarter of the current financial year 2080/081. The bank has earned a profit of 1.52 billion in the first quarter of the current year. During the same period of the previous year, the profit of the bank was limited to 1.14 billion.

This bank is at the forefront in earning net profit. In the first quarter, Nabil Bank earned 1.46 billion, Global IME Bank 1.22 billion, NIC Asia Bank 1.1 billion, Prime Commercial Bank 1.15 billion, Himalayan Bank 1.55 billion, Laxmi Sunrise Bank 1.3 billion. have done

Operating profit, which was limited to 1.62 billion rupees in the first quarter of last year, has increased to 2.60 billion rupees in the current year. The operating profit of Nepal Investment Bank increased by 59.90 percent to 2.6 billion 54 lakh. Last year, the profit was more than 1 billion 62 million 93 million. This bank has set aside 64.6 million rupees for impresario charge. Last year, 28 crore 16 lakh rupees were allotted under this title. Due to the increase in bad loans, its impairment charge has also increased.

Currently, the paid-up capital of this bank is 34 billion 128 million rupees. Its reserve fund has a total of 25 billion 89 million 38 million rupees. Bank's NPL has increased to 4.83 percent. Last year it was 1.57 percent. Its earnings per share decreased from 24 rupees 92 paisa to 17 rupees 84 paisa. The net worth per share also decreased by 18 rupees 95 paisa to 173 rupees 37 paisa. That is why the distributable profit of the bank is negative.
